The UAE’s push for inclusivity has reached the toy aisle with the arrival of Mattel’s first-ever autistic Barbie. This milestone release aims to provide ‘representation for every child,’ ensuring that the neurodivergent community in the Emirates sees themselves reflected in a global icon. 

Developed with the Autistic Self Advocacy Network (ASAN), the doll moves beyond aesthetics to incorporate functional features that mirror real-world experiences.

Unlike traditional dolls, this Barbie is equipped with flexible joints to mimic self-regulatory gestures and eyes that look slightly to the side, reflecting common sensory preferences within the community.

 Local families have welcomed the move, noting that such toys help foster empathy and understanding from a young age. To further support the cause, Mattel has committed to donating 1,000 dolls to specialized pediatric hospitals, cementing the doll's role as both a plaything and a tool for social progress.
